π― Quick Answer
To ensure your women's charms & charm bracelets are recommended by ChatGPT, Perplexity, and Google AI systems, focus on detailed product descriptions with relevant keywords, implement comprehensive schema markup, gather verified customer reviews, optimize images and videos, and provide thorough FAQ content about material, size, and style options.

β Frequently Asked Questions
How do AI assistants recommend products?+
AI assistants analyze product reviews, ratings, price positioning, availability, and schema markup to make recommendations.
How many reviews does a product need to rank well?+
Products with 100+ verified reviews see significantly better AI recommendation rates.
What's the minimum rating for AI recommendation?+
Products generally need at least a 4.0-star rating, with higher ratings increasing recommendation likelihood.
Does product price affect AI recommendations?+
Yes, competitively priced products are favored, especially when aligned with buyer intent signals.
Do product reviews need to be verified?+
Verified reviews are prioritized by AI algorithms as they signal authentic user experiences.
Should I focus on Amazon or my own site?+
Optimizing product data on all channels, especially those with strong AI signals like Amazon, enhances overall AI discoverability.
How do I handle negative product reviews?+
Address negative reviews transparently and encourage satisfied customers to post positive feedback to balance the signal.
What content ranks best for product AI recommendations?+
Content that includes detailed descriptions, rich media, and comprehensive FAQs helps AI match products to buyer queries.
Do social mentions help product AI ranking?+
Yes, active social mentions and backlinks can signal popularity, enhancing AI recommendations.
Can I rank for multiple product categories?+
Yes, by creating category-specific descriptions and schema markup, you can target multiple related categories.
How often should I update product information?+
Regular updates, at least quarterly, help keep product data relevant for ongoing AI discovery.
Will AI product ranking replace traditional SEO?+
AI ranking complements SEO efforts but does not eliminate the need for traditional optimization practices.
